Unique Hebrew Boy Names And Meanings

Unique Hebrew Boy Names 1

Hebrew names are deeply rooted in the Hebrew language and are commonly used by Jews. They are often associated with historical and biblical significance. Explore our list of unique Hebrew boy names, each with its own special meaning and rich heritage.

  1. Adam – A Hebrew name that means man, mankind
  2. Aharon (Aaron) – It was the name of the older brother of Moses.
  3. Barak – A Hebrew name that means lightning
  4. Dan – A Hebrew name that means judge. Dan was Jacob’s son.
  5. Efraim – Efraim was Jacob’s grandson.
  6. Feivel – A Hebrew name that means bright one
  7. Hadar – A Hebrew name that means beautiful, ornamented, or honored
  8. Hillel – Hillel means praise
  9. Issachar – Issachar means there is a reward
  10. Jacob (Yaacov) – A Hebrew name that means held by the heel
  11. Josiah – It was the name of a king who ascended the throne at the age of eight when his father was murdered.
  12. Katriel – A Hebrew name that means God is my crown.
  13. Malachi – It was the name of a prophet in the Bible.
  14. Natan – It was the name of a prophet. Natan means gift.
  15. Noach (Noah) – Noah means rest, quiet, and peace.
  16. Ofer – A Hebrew name that means young mountain goat or young deer
  17. Omr – Omri was the name of a king of Israel who sinned.
  18. Reuven (Reuben) – Reuven means behold, a son!
  19. Ro’i – A Hebrew name that means my shepherd
  20. Samuel – Samuel was the name of a prophet.
  21. Saul – Saul was the name of the first king of Israel.
  22. Uziel – A Hebrew name that means God is my strength.
  23. Zakai – A Hebrew name that means pure, clean, innocent

Cute Hebrew Baby Boy Names

Cute Hebrew baby boy names blend charm with meaning, making them perfect for a little one whose name will grow with them through the years. From timeless classics to modern favorites, you will find a delightful selection of names that capture both innocence and tradition.

  1. Alon – A Hebrew name that means oak tree.
  2. Ami – A Hebrew name that means my people.
  3. Amos – Amos was the name of an 8th-century prophet from northern Israel.
  4. Ariel – A Hebrew name for Jerusalem that means lion of God
  5. Bela – Bela was the name of one of Jacob’s grandsons in the Bible.
  6. Ben – A Hebrew name that means son
  7. Daniel – Daniel was the name of an interpreter of dreams in the Book of Daniel.
  8. Elad – Elad, derived from Ephraim’s tribe, means God is eternal.
  9. Gad – A Hebrew name, Gad was Jacob’s son in the Bible.
  10. Hadriel – A Hebrew name that means Splendor of the Lord.
  11. Hod – Hod means splendor. It was the name of a member of Asher’s tribe.
  12. Isaiah – Isaiah was one of the prophets of the Bible
  13. Jeremiah – Jeremiah was one of the Hebrew prophets in the Bible.
  14. Levi – Levi means joined or attendant upon.
  15. Malkiel – A Hebrew name that means My King is God.
  16. Maoz – A Hebrew name that means strength of the Lord
  17. Ovadya – A Hebrew name that means servant of God

Cool Jewish Boy Names

While Hebrew names are a subset of Jewish names, Jewish names can come from various languages and cultures. For instance, Elijah is a popular Hebrew name among Jewish individuals, whereas Isidore is a Jewish name with Greek origins. 

  1. Aryeh – Aryeh means lion.
  2. Asher – It was the name of the son of Yaakov. Asher means blessed.
  3. Avichai – A Hebrew name that means my father (or God) lives.
  4. Ben-Ami – A Hebrew name that means son of my people.
  5. Chai – A Hebrew name that means life. It is an important symbol in Jewish culture.
  6. David – It was the name of the Biblical hero.
  7. Gavriel (Gabriel) – Gavriel (Gabriel) is the name of an angel who visited Daniel in the Bible. Gavriel means God is my strength.
  8. Israel – Israel means to wrestle with God.
  9. Jonathan (Yonatan) – It was the name of King Saul’s son and King David’s best friend in the Bible.
  10. Micah – A Hebrew name of a prophet
  11. Michael – It is the name of an angel and messenger of God in the Bible. The name means Who is like God?
  12. Tamir – A Hebrew name that means tall and stately.​
  13. Uriel – Uriel means God is my light.

Strong Hebrew Boy Names

If you have Israeli heritage or a connection to Israel, you might want to reflect that in your child’s name. Traditionally, choosing Hebrew or Israeli names involves giving equal importance to the name’s meaning, spelling, sound, and pronunciation.

Some Jewish naming practices are also worth considering, although they are more guidelines than strict rules. For example, some Jewish communities avoid naming babies after living relatives, while others do not have this restriction.

  1. Aviel – A Hebrew name that means my father is God.
  2. Avner – Avner means father (or God) of light.
  3. Benyamin (Benjamin) – Benyamin was Jacob’s youngest son. Benyamin means son of my right-hand
  4. Eliezer – Eliezer means my God helps.
  5. Eliahu (Elijah) – Eliahu (Elijah) was a prophet.
  6. Gershem – In the Bible, Gershem was Nehemiah’s adversary.
  7. Haran is a Hebrew name that means mountaineer or mountain people.
  8. Jethro – Jethro was Moses’ father-in-law.
  9. Kefir – A Hebrew name that means young cub or lion
  10. Moses (Moshe) – Moses means drawn out in Hebrew.
  11. Shalev – A Hebrew name that means peaceful
  12. Shaul (Saul) – A Hebrew name. Shaul was a king of Israel.
  13. Shimon (Simon) – A Hebrew name. Shimon was Jacob’s son.

Modern Hebrew Boy Names

  1. Avraham (Abraham) – Avraham was the father of the Jewish people.
  2. Chasdiel – A Hebrew name that means my God is gracious.
  3. Dotan – Dotan, a place in Israel, means law.
  4. Gidon (Gideon) – Gidon (Gideon) was a biblical warrior hero.
  5. Harel – A Hebrew name that means mountain of God
  6. Itai – Itai means friendly.
  7. Joel (Yoel) – Joel was a prophet. Yoel means God is willing.
  8. Jonah (Yonah) – Jonah was a prophet. Yonah means dove.
  9. Menashe – Menashe was Joseph’s son. The name means causing to forget.
  10. Zechariah (Zachary) – Zachariah means remembering God.​ It was the name of a prophet in the Bible.
  11. Ze’ev – A Hebrew name that means wolf.​

Unique Jewish Boy Names

  1. Avram – Avram was Abraham’s original name.
  2. Bartholomew – From Hebrew words for hill or furrow.
  3. Baruch – A Hebrew name that means blessed
  4. Ezra – Ezra means help in Hebrew.
  5. Gilad – Gilad means endless joy.
  6. Hevel – A Hebrew name that means breath, vapor
  7. Itamar – Itamar means island of palm (trees).
  8. Joseph (Yosef) – A Hebrew name that means God will add or increase.
  9. Pinchas – It was the name of the grandson of Aaron in the Bible.
  10. Raphael – It was the name of an angel in the Bible. Raphael means God heals.
